Apply constant pressure and dont give him time to think because if you do, he well constantly space you and wall you out with his moves. Get up close and personal with him. You can be just outside of grab range. This will pressure the mk to make a move and then you can react and punch accordingly. F-smash him when he tries to ledgehop>nado to get back on stage.Any tips against MK? :/

- Bait B-Air/F-air, shield, then OoS N-Air him.
- Minute wafts are good here.
- Don't rush in, he's got good tilts and smashes.
- B-Air when he's offstage, but don't chase him to far.
- Butt taunt.
- Clap is really handy. Don't risk clapping his D-Air.
- Watch for his F-Smash. Kills early.
